Talk and Presentation

The South East Animal Rights Group (SEAR) has invited us to talk at one of their monthly meetings in Croydon.  I will be talking about the Moon Bear Rescue and Friends or... Food? campaigns and will have the latest updates from China and Vietnam. We will also show the DVD "Moon Bear Rescue - A Decade On"

 

This will be a great opportunity to talk to other like minded people who may not know very much about Animals Asia and raise more awareness.
